The Stanley Cup Final is heating up as the Edmonton Oilers face elimination in Game 6 against the Florida Panthers. With uncertainty surrounding their goaltending situation, fans are left wondering who will step up at this critical juncture. As of 2025-06-17 19:39:00, head coach Kris Knoblauch remains undecided between Stuart Skinner and Calvin Pickard.

The Panthers have surged to the brink of clinching their second consecutive Cup, largely due to the stellar performances of Sergei Bobrovsky. In contrast, the Oilers have had a turbulent journey in net, oscillating between Skinner and Pickard throughout the playoffs. This dilemma raises the question: can Edmonton find a reliable netminder to support their star-studded roster?
